gstglx11

package
v0.0.0-...-ccbbe8a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 7, 2023 License: MPL-2.0 Imports: 8 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	GTypeGLDisplaYX11 = coreglib.Type(C.gst_gl_display_x11_get_type())
)

GType values.

Functions

This section is empty.

Types

type GLDisplaYX11

type GLDisplaYX11 struct {
	gstgl.GLDisplay
	// contains filtered or unexported fields
}

GLDisplaYX11 contents of a GLDisplayX11 are private and should only be accessed through the provided API.

func NewGLDisplaYX11

func NewGLDisplaYX11(name string) *GLDisplaYX11

NewGLDisplaYX11: create a new GLDisplayX11 from the x11 display name. See XOpenDisplay() for details on what is a valid name.

The function takes the following parameters:

  • name (optional): display name.

The function returns the following values:

  • glDisplayX11: new GLDisplayX11 or NULL.

type GLDisplaYX11Class

type GLDisplaYX11Class struct {
	// contains filtered or unexported fields
}

GLDisplaYX11Class: instance of this type is always passed by reference.

func (*GLDisplaYX11Class) ObjectClass

func (g *GLDisplaYX11Class) ObjectClass() *gstgl.GLDisplayClass

func (*GLDisplaYX11Class) Padding

func (g *GLDisplaYX11Class) Padding() [4]unsafe.Pointer

type GLDisplaYX11Overrides

type GLDisplaYX11Overrides struct {
}

GLDisplaYX11Overrides contains methods that are overridable.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L